A major CGIAR national consultation was as carried out in Hanoi, Vietnam on 14 and 15 December 2015. The national consultations are an integral part of the third Global Conference on Agricultural Research for Development, a two-year consultation process focusing on stakeholder and partner priorities at the national and regional level designed to help shape the strategy and future direction of international agriculture research and innovation. 

The Vietnam National Consultation is part of a series of GCARD3 consultations taking place through 2015 and 2016 in a set of countries identified through agreed criteria by CGIAR Centers and Research Programs (CRPs), with input from other stakeholder groups. More than 40 national research institutes and partners met to discuss the most significant challenges to agriculture in the country, and strategies for increasing crop productivity and incomes.
